Q1: What is density?
A: Density is mass per unit volume, typically measured in grams per milliliter (g/mL) for liquids.
Q2: What's the density of water?
A: Pure water has a density of 1.0 g/mL at 4°C, which is used as the standard reference.
Q3: Where can I find density values for other substances?
A: Density tables are available in chemistry references, material safety data sheets (MSDS), or online databases.
Q4: Does temperature affect density?
A: Yes, density typically decreases with increasing temperature for liquids and gases.
Q5: Can I use this for non-liquid substances?
A: Yes, as long as you have the correct density value, it works for solids and gases too.
